At its core, the EasyWare Multi-Key File Generator is a batch-processing engine. Instead of manually creating one key at a time using random number generators or scripts, users can specify parameters—such as key length, character sets (alphanumeric, hexadecimal, or base64), prefix/suffix patterns, and checksum requirements—and produce hundreds or thousands of unique keys within seconds. The “multi-key” descriptor is thus not merely a feature but the product’s raison d’être. Furthermore, the “file generator” aspect automates the output stage, collating the generated keys into structured file formats like CSV, JSON, XML, or plain text. This feature is indispensable for system administrators, software vendors, and cybersecurity professionals who need to provision credentials in bulk for user accounts, trial licenses, or hardware tokens.
Beyond raw generation, the utility of such a tool lies in its ability to enforce uniqueness and collision avoidance. A poorly designed key generator might inadvertently create duplicate keys, leading to authorization conflicts and security holes. EasyWare’s approach typically employs cryptographically secure pseudorandom number generators (CSPRNGs) alongside stateful tracking to ensure that no key is repeated within a batch or across previously generated sets. This transforms the tool from a simple script into a reliable authority for identity issuance.
Another critical dimension is quality control through validation rules. Many real-world keys require built-in error detection. For instance, software license keys often include a checksum digit to verify integrity. The EasyWare generator can incorporate such logic, producing keys that automatically pass validation routines in downstream applications. This preemptive design saves developers countless hours of debugging malformed keys and enhances user experience by reducing activation failures.

Yet, no discussion of a key generator would be complete without addressing security considerations. The power to mass-produce keys is also a potential weapon for misuse. An adversary with access to EasyWare could generate valid keys for a software product if they understood its key derivation logic. Consequently, responsible use demands that the generator be deployed in secure, air-gapped or strictly controlled environments for production key issuance. Many implementations address this by integrating hardware security modules (HSMs) or salting generated keys with a master secret not stored in the tool itself. Additionally, the output files must be protected with appropriate file permissions, encryption at rest, and secure transmission channels.

Enter the Easyware Multi-Key File Generator—a specialized utility built to streamline the creation of multi-key files. What is a Multi-Key File?
Before diving into the tool, it is helpful to understand the "why." A multi-key file allows a single data structure or license file to be accessed or validated using different identifiers (keys). This is crucial for:
Flexible Licensing: Allowing a single software package to be activated via different serial types.
Data Indexing: Enabling databases to retrieve records using multiple unique fields.
Security Layers: Implementing tiered access where different keys grant different levels of permission. Key Features of the Easyware Generator
